POMT1 (Protein O mannosyl transferase 1) is a multipass membrane protein that is found in the endoplasmic reticulum. POMT1 catalyses the transfer of mannosyl residues to the hydroxyl groups of serine or threonine residues. Enzymatic activity is dependent on co expression of POMT1 with POMT2. Defects in the POMT1 gene are associated with Walker-Warburg syndrome (WWS), a congential muscular dystrophy that is associated with mental retardation and is usually lethal within the first few months of life. Other defects in the POMT1 gene result in limb girdle muscular dystrophy type 2K (LGMD2K), which is associated with mild mental retardation. Studies in Drosophila suggest that mutation of POMT1 alters the efficacy of synaptic transmission and a change in subunit composition of post synaptic glutamate receptors at the neuromuscular junction. Missense mutations in POMT1 have been associated with glioneuronal and glial brain tumours.
